Tiger Woods, the iconic figure of modern golf, is on the brink of a momentous return to the sport’s grandest stage at The Masters next week, igniting a wave of anticipation and speculation among fans and pundits alike. After an agonizing absence from competitive play spanning nearly 14 months, during which he grappled with injuries, surgeries, and the daunting aftermath of a life-threatening car accident, Woods is set to address the global media frenzy at Augusta National on Tuesday, just days before the tournament tees off.
Once perched atop the pinnacle of golfing glory with an unparalleled record of 15 major championship victories, Woods has endured a dramatic descent in the rankings, currently languishing at a humbling position of world No. 950. Yet, his enduring aura of greatness persists, buoyed by a recent practice round at Augusta, where he shared the fairways and greens with close friend and fellow competitor Justin Thomas. This symbolic return to the hallowed grounds of Augusta National not only underscores Woods’ resilience but also stirs memories of his past triumphs and the enduring allure of his storied career.
As he braces himself for his 26th appearance at The Masters, Woods harbors ambitions of eclipsing longstanding records, particularly the mark for consecutive cuts made at Augusta, a feat currently shared with golfing luminaries Gary Player and Fred Couples. However, the odds stacked against him loom large, with skeptics citing his prolonged absence and diminished form as significant hurdles to overcome. Despite his undeniable talent and indomitable spirit, the road to glory at Augusta appears fraught with challenges, compounded by the uncertainties surrounding his physical condition and match readiness.
The narrative surrounding Woods’ return is fraught with poignant subplots, chief among them the looming milestone of the fifth anniversary of his historic fifth Masters triumph in 2019, a victory that captivated the sporting world and solidified his status as a transcendent figure in the annals of golfing lore.
